Here is a closer look. The scallop heart is punched from kraft card stock that has been inked on the edges and stamped with a Hero Arts Collage Stamp. The paper is from K & Co. Cut and Paste collection. The butterfly is also a Hero Arts stamp. Several of the stamps are sold out on 2peas. I've bought some of mine right from the Hero Arts web site too.

This one also used a Hero Arts Stamp for the grid/scroll design. Then I added an old dictionary page I got from Nora Griffin's Etsy shop The rest was just odds and ends from my stash including the vintage buttons which I think I picked up at Covered Bridge 2 years ago. They are in this great old ball canning jar that has a glass lid.

This was the first one I made and I had a heck of a time coming up with a design. I think I probably have 5 basic designs in my head and I just keep recycling them and kidding myself that it looks new and different! Ha!! Again the papers are from the K & Co Cut & Paste line. The butterfly punches are made with my Martha Stewart punch. The flower is prima and I've had it forever.... Sometimes cards are a good way to use up old supplies.
